Transaction f21673ba2e461c78df20974ea8c3f4823ab3c7c64dbf6ae5610fa5681010933f
1 Input
1 Output
-
f21673ba2e461c78df20974ea8c3f4823ab3c7c64dbf6ae5610fa5681010933f:0
- value
- 51368640
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2c3a993ba754f539293428391239953b7b1662a5 OP_EQUAL
- address
- 35isrV2fbDXW19pYK1ekUJigr5LjwEEv6G